WHEEL CONTROL, HUB

Number Designation Model 190 Model 197
BA33.20-P-1002-01P Nut, upper transverse control arm to steering knuckle Stage 1 Nm 40 40
Stage 2 ∠° 90 90
WHEEL CONTROL, HUB

Number Designation Model 190 Model 197
BA33.20-P-1003-01P Nut, lower transverse control arm to steering knuckle Stage 1 Nm 70 70
Stage 2 ∠° 90 90

  1. Unscrew self-locking nut (1) from supporting ball joint (2).
  2. SPECIAL TOOL Screw thrust piece (043) onto supporting ball joint (2).

    IMPORTANTSPECIAL TOOL Use 129 589 10 63 00 on upper ball joint at top and SPECIAL TOOL 140 589 00 63 00 supporting ball joint (2) at bottom.

  3. Pry off supporting ball joint (2) using SPECIAL TOOL puller (044) and SPECIAL TOOL press (045).

    NOTES Do not damage seal bellows.

    Otherwise, the supporting ball joint (2) must be replaced.

  4. SPECIAL TOOL Remove puller (044), SPECIAL TOOL press (045) and SPECIAL TOOL thrust piece (043).

    Mount 

  5. Clean tapered connection.

    INSTALLATION NOTES Ensure that the conical joint and threads are free of oil and grease.

    Otherwise, a correct connection will not be assured.

  6. Replace self-locking nut (1) on supporting ball joint (2) TORQUE SPECIFICATION or on upper ball joint TORQUE SPECIFICATION and tighten.
